  • Potassium phosphates (E340)Low

    Inorganic phosphate additives are highly bioavailable; high additive-phosphate intake is associated with increased cardiovascular and kidney burden, particularly in chronic kidney disease.

Dark chocolate (sugar, chocolate liquor (processed with alkali), cocoa butter, soy lecithin (emulsifier), vanilla extract), caramel center (evaporated milk [milk, dipotassium phosphate, carrageenan, vitamin d3], glucose syrup, sugar, invertase, cream, non-hydrogenated palm kernel oil, butter [cream and salt], salt, vanilla extract), sea salt.
